Fanatics Betting and Gaming is hiring a Senior Software Engineer to design, develop, and maintain high-quality, scalable backend systems that power customer experiences. You will apply strong technical skills and a collaborative approach to solve complex problems in our fast-paced industry.
What You'll Do
- Design, develop, test, and deploy backend services using Java, Spring Boot, and AWS.
- Build scalable, low-latency distributed systems for iCasino experiences across web and mobile.
- Collaborate with engineers, product managers, and stakeholders to deliver features aligned with the product roadmap.
- Participate in code reviews, sprint planning, architectural reviews, and process improvements.
- Contribute to discovery and design for complex technical projects, translating business needs into technical solutions.
- Partner with Product, Design, DevOps, and Security in a highly regulated production environment.
- Participate in an on-call rotation to assist with incident response and production support.
- Operate within Agile methodologies and share progress in daily stand-ups and retrospectives.
- Stay current with the latest technologies, tools, and engineering best practices.
- Be open to occasional travel for collaboration, planning, or team-building.
What We're Looking For
- 7+ years of professional software engineering experience with a backend focus.
- 3+ years building backend applications with Java and the Spring Framework.
- Expertise in software engineering principles, architectural patterns, and system design.
- Solid understanding of RESTful service design, distributed systems, data modeling, caching, and database technologies (SQL and/or NoSQL).
- Strong skills in a CI/CD environment and knowledge of design principles for performance, maintainability, and scalability.
- Experience with Agile/SCRUM methodologies and cross-functional team collaboration.
- Strong problem-solving skills and a proactive, ownership-oriented mindset.
- Clear communication skills for explaining technical concepts to peers and non-engineers.
- Ability to navigate shifting priorities in a fast-paced, high-growth setting.
- Demonstrated ability to collaborate with cross-functional teams and external partners.
Nice to Have
- Hands-on experience with AWS cloud services and tools like Terraform, CI/CD, Datadog, or CloudWatch.
- Exposure to startup or hyper-growth environments with a pragmatic approach to MVPs.
- Experience with the React library.
- Familiarity with CI/CD practices, cloud platforms, or DevOps workflows.
- Ability to work effectively cross-functionally within an enterprise environment.
Technical Stack
- Java, Spring Boot, AWS, Terraform, Datadog, CloudWatch, React, Kotlin Multiplatform
Team & Environment
You will work in a cross-functional team collaborating with engineers, product managers, and other stakeholders.
Benefits & Compensation
- Annual salary range: $121,600 - $200,000 plus eligibility for an equity award.
- Medical, Dental, Vision, and 401K.
- Paid time off.
- GymPass membership.
- Pet Insurance.
- Family Care Benefits.
- $700 home office setup stipend.
Work Mode
This is a hybrid role with offices in New York, Denver, Leeds, and Dublin.
Fanatics Betting and Gaming is an equal opportunity employer.



